DALLAS -- La Quinta Inns & Suites, the fastest-growing select service brand in the hotel industry, has reached an agreement with Idaho-based AmeriTel Inns Inc., to convert three AmeriTel Inn & Suites, representing more than 300 rooms, to the La Quinta flag.
The first hotel, located in Twin Falls, will begin operating as a La Quinta Inn & Suites within 90-120 days, followed by hotels in Boise and Idaho Falls. Additional agreements between La Quinta and AmeriTel are expected in the near future.
"We are delighted to welcome AmeriTel to the La Quinta franchise system, as we announce the first in a series of agreements that will further accelerate our franchise growth," said Rajiv Trivedi, La Quinta's Executive Vice President and Chief Development Officer. Trivedi concluded, "We look forward to a long and mutually beneficial relationship with AmeriTel and its owners, the Black family - we could not hope for better or more experienced operators in the Idaho and Pacific Northwest markets."
AmeriTel was founded in the 1990s currently owns and operates 13 properties in Idaho and Utah, in the select service, upscale and all-suite segments under the AmeriTel Inns flag, as well as Hilton brands.
